Suresh Gyan Vihar University Cutoff refers to the minimum score a candidate needs to obtain in order to be eligible for admission. The cutoff for SGVU is determined on the basis of entrance exams like SGVUEE (Suresh Gyan Vihar University Entrance Exam), JEE Main for engineering courses and CAT/MAT for MBA programs. Candidates need to obtain the closing rank for respective exams as a selection requirement. The SGVU cutoff might vary yearly depending on various factors.

Course Name | Fees | Eligibility |
B.Tech. (Bachelor of Technology) | ₹80,000 - 1,40,000 | 10+2 education with Physics, Mathematics, and Chemistry as compulsory subjects, Minimum aggregate score of 45% (40% for reserved categories), Valid rank in a national-level or state-level engineering entrance examination |
M.B.A. (Master of Business Administration) | ₹1,60,000 - 4,00,000 | Undergraduate degree from a recognized university, Minimum aggregate score of 50%, Qualifying score in national-level management entrance exams (CAT, MAT, XAT, CMAT) |
P.G.D.M. (Post Graduate Diploma in Management) | ₹12,00,000 | |
B.Des. (Bachelor of Design) | ₹3,00,000 - 4,50,000 | |
B.Sc. (Bachelor of Science) | ₹39,800 - 1,20,000 | Higher secondary education (10+2) from a recognized board, Minimum aggregate score of 50% in the science stream, Studied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ics or Biology as core subjects during 10+2 education |
B.A. (Bachelor of Arts) | ₹48,000 - 80,000 | 10+2 education from a recognized board or equivalent, minimum percentage requirement set by the university |
B.B.A. (Bachelor of Business Administration) | ₹80,000 - 2,00,000 | 10+2 education from a recognized board, minimum aggregate of 50%, strong command of the English language, good communication skills, keen interest in business and management studies |
B.C.A. (Bachelor of Computer Applications) | ₹80,000 - 2,50,000 | 10+2 education from a recognized board, minimum aggregate of 50%, studied Mathematics as a compulsory subject, completed a diploma in Computer Applications or equivalent |
B.Com. (Bachelor of Commerce) | ₹90,000 - 1,50,000 | |
B.Pharm. (Bachelor of Pharmacy) | ₹1,20,000 | 10+2 examination with Physics, Chemistry, and Biology/Mathematics as compulsory subjects, minimum aggregate of 50% marks in the qualifying examination |
Diploma | ₹39,800 - 55,000 | 10+2 or equivalent examination from a recognized board, minimum percentage criteria set by the university for admission to the Diploma program |
M.Sc. (Master of Science) | ₹48,000 - 80,000 | Bachelor's degree in a relevant field, Minimum aggregate score of 50% in qualifying examination |
M.A. (Master of Arts) | ₹80,000 | Bachelor's degree in the relevant field, Minimum qualifying marks may vary depending on specialization |
M.Tech. (Master of Technology) | ₹80,000 - 1,20,000 | |
M.C.A. (Master of Computer Applications) | ₹90,000 - 1,00,000 | |
M.Pharm. (Master of Pharmacy) | ₹1,00,000 | Bachelor's degree in Pharmacy, Minimum aggregate of 50%, Valid score in relevant entrance exam |
Ph.D. (Doctor of Philosophy) | ₹1,20,000 | |
Diploma in Pharmacy | ₹90,000 | |
LL.M. (Master of Law) | ₹48,000 - 72,000 | |
B.P.T. (Bachelor of Physiotherapy) | ₹90,000 | |
M.P.T. (Master of Physiotherapy) | ₹70,000 | |
BBA+LLB | ₹1,20,000 | |
Bachelor in Tourism and Hotel Management | ₹70,000 | |
Bachelor in Sports Management | ₹1,20,000 |

There are various factors that determine the cutoff for SGVU:
Number of Applicants: Higher number of applicants leads to higher cutoffs due to increased competition.
Difficulty of Entrance Exam: If the exam is considered difficult, cutoffs may be lower; conversely easier exams tend to result in higher cutoffs.
Number of Available Seats: Fewer available seats increase competition driving up cutoff scores.
Previous Year's Cutoff Trends: Colleges often consider these as benchmarks.
Reservation Policies: Different categories (e.g., SC/ST/OBC) result in varying cutoffs.
Popularity of Courses: Highly popular courses will have higher cutoffs.
